2010-01-25Split libAnalysis into two libraries: libAnalysis and libChecker.Ted Kremenek
(1) libAnalysis is a generic analysis library that can be used by Sema. It defines the CFG, basic dataflow analysis primitives, and inexpensive flow-sensitive analyses (e.g. LiveVariables). (2) libChecker contains the guts of the static analyzer, incuding the path-sensitive analysis engine and domain-specific checks. Now any clients that want to use the frontend to build their own tools don't need to link in the entire static analyzer. This change exposes various obvious cleanups that can be made to the layout of files and headers in libChecker. More changes pending. :) This change also exposed a layering violation between AnalysisContext and MemRegion. BlockInvocationContext shouldn't explicitly know about BlockDataRegions. For now I've removed the BlockDataRegion* from BlockInvocationContext (removing context-sensitivity; although this wasn't used yet). 2009-06-26Introduce a new concept to the static analyzer: SValuator.Ted Kremenek
GRTransferFuncs had the conflated role of both constructing SVals (symbolic expressions) as well as handling checker-specific logic. Now SValuator has the role of constructing SVals from expressions and GRTransferFuncs just handles checker-specific logic. The motivation is by separating these two concepts we will be able to much more easily create richer constraint-generating logic without coupling it to the main checker transfer function logic. We now have one implementation of SValuator: SimpleSValuator. SimpleSValuator is essentially the SVal-related logic that was in GRSimpleVals (which is removed in this patch). This includes the logic for EvalBinOp, EvalCast, etc. Because SValuator has a narrower role than the old GRTransferFuncs, the interfaces are much simpler, and so is the implementation of SimpleSValuator compared to GRSimpleVals. I also did a line-by-line review of SVal-related logic in GRSimpleVals and cleaned it up while moving it over to SimpleSValuator. As a consequence of removing GRSimpleVals, there is no longer a '-checker-simple' option. The '-checker-cfref' did everything that option did but also ran the retain/release checker. Of course a user may not always wish to run the retain/release checker, nor do we wish core analysis logic buried in the checker-specific logic. 2009-02-04Overhaul BugReporter interface and implementation. The new interface cleans upTed Kremenek
the ownership of BugTypes and BugReports. Now BugReports are owned by BugTypes, and BugTypes are owned by the BugReporter object. The major functionality change in this patch is that reports are not immediately emitted by a call to BugReporter::EmitWarning (now called EmitReport), but instead of queued up in report "equivalence classes". When BugReporter::FlushReports() is called, it emits one diagnostic per report equivalence class. This provides a nice cleanup with the caching of reports as well as enables the BugReporter engine to select the "best" path for reporting a path-sensitive bug based on all the locations in the ExplodedGraph that the same bug could occur.
